Shallow M6.0 earthquake hits Nias region, Indonesia

A strong and shallow earthquake registered by the USGS as M6.0 hit the Nias region of Indonesia at 23:58 UTC on April 19, 2021, at a depth of 10 km (6.2 miles). EMSC is reporting the same magnitude and depth.

The epicenter was located about 257 km (160 miles) S of Sinabang and 273 km (170 miles) SSW of Singkil, Aceh, Indonesia.

There are no people living within 100 km (62 miles).

117 000 people are estimated to have felt light shaking.
